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between a 1040 and a 1040ez?

The only real difference between the forms is in the amount of information reported. The IRS has a list of items, which if reported on your return, require using either the Form 1040A or Form 1040 instead of Form 1040EZ.

Who should use 1040ez form?

There are many reasons that taxpayers should complete the document. 1040EZ Form is used to calculate the tax owed and what will be returned to the taxpayer. It should only be completed when the taxpayer has no other items to take into account in their taxes.

When to use 1040ez?

You must use Form 1040 if:

  • Your taxable income is $100,000 or more
  • You claim Schedule A itemized deductions
  • You report self-employment income (Schedule C) or
  • You report income from sale of a property or you need to report stock sales (Schedule D & Form 8949).

Who can use 1040ez form?

Taxpayers can use the 1040EZ if they are filing as single or married filing jointly without dependents and they meet certain income requirements. A form 1040EZ is suitable for a single person or married couple without children who can meet income requirements.
